"Rule / Sparkle" Cover
Artist
Hamasaki Ayumi
Song
Sparkle
Lyrics
Hamasaki Ayumi
Music
Hara Kazuhiro
Other Information
Arrangement: CMJK
Programming, Guitar & Bass: CMJK
Mixed by Morimoto Koji


"Sparkle" is a song recorded by Hamasaki Ayumi, first released as an A-side on her single "Rule / Sparkle". The song is described as a having modern techno-dance style, a new sound to Hamasaki at the time. It was used as a CM theme song for Honda Zest Spark.

Music Video

PV Shot

The PV for "Sparkle" was directed by Shimomura Kazuyoshi. The opening sequence is a recreation of the television show The Best Ten.

Disambiguation

The following are the different versions of this song released throughout Hamasaki Ayumi's discography, listed chronologically.

Sparkle
Found on the "Rule / Sparkle" single as track #2 and on NEXT LEVEL as track #5. This is the main version of the song, often referred to as "Original mix".
Sparkle (Original mix -Instrumental-)
Found on all of the "Rule / Sparkle" singles. This is the standard version of the song without the vocals.
Sparkle (ARENA TOUR 2009 Live)
Found on ayumi hamasaki ARENA TOUR 2009 A ~NEXT LEVEL~ as track #17. The arrangement is similar to the standard version of the song with an extended ending.
